Low-cost Multi-Channel Interface for Passive Resistive Sensors

Zivko Kokolanski, Cvetan Gavrovski, Vladimir Dimcev, Dimitar Taskovski
Abstract:
The paper elaborates the design and implementation of a low-cost multichannel interface for passive resistive sensors. The interface is based on a multivibrator in a monostabile configuration and is suitable for direct interface to a programmable devices (e.g. microcontrollers, field programmable gate arrays, etc.). In the paper, details concerning the sensor interface are presented, and different calibration techniques are described. The theoretical analysis are supported by a practical implementation.
